Jason Sadler Named CEO of CIGNA International Health, Life & Accident
PHILADELPHIA--(BUSINESS WIRE)-- Jason Sadler has been appointed to lead the Health, Life & Accident (HL&A) operations of CIGNA International, a world leader in direct marketed global health, accident and life insurance, effective July 19, 2010. Sadler will be based in Hong Kong and report to CIGNA International President William L. Atwell. He will be responsible for leading and expanding CIGNA's HL&A business globally.
“Jason’s insurance career spans 21 years and we’re very fortunate to gain his expertise and knowledge of the industry,” said Atwell. “With his breadth of experience and strong leadership skills, I'm confident he'll be a great success in leading our team to meet our aggressive growth objectives – particularly in Asia.”
Sadler spent the last 16 years at HSBC serving in leadership positions with increasing responsibility in the United Kingdom, Singapore and Hong Kong. He most recently held the position of managing director for the insurance business for Hong Kong, responsible for the life, general, medical and corporate retirement business. Under Sadler’s leadership and for the first time in HSBC history, all four businesses lines were rated #1 in their respective segments for new business premiums in 2009.
Prior to that, Sadler held management positions with AXA Insurance in the UK and Zurich Financial Services. Sadler earned a Bachelor of Science degree in business studies from Swansea University in Wales, United Kingdom. He is a member of the Chartered Institute of Management Accountants.
About CIGNA International
CIGNA International is part of CIGNA (NYSE:CI), a global health service and related insurance company dedicated to helping people improve their health, well-being and sense of security. CIGNA Corporation's operating subsidiaries in the United States provide an integrated suite of medical, dental, behavioral health, pharmacy and vision care benefits, as well as group life, accident and disability insurance. Outside the U.S. CIGNA delivers access to superior quality health care and related financial protection programs to employers, affinity groups and individuals. CIGNA actively sells in 27 countries and jurisdictions and serves expatriates virtually everywhere in the world. On a global scale, CIGNA serves some 46 million people.
